Debris Flow — Tuolumne, California

2017-09-13 · near Tuolumne Meadows, Tuolumne, California

Event narrative

A Yosemite National Park employee reported a rock slide over Park Road near Hetch Hetchy.

Wider weather episode

The upper level low which had remained off the California coast for several days finally moved inland across Southern California on September 13 and produced enough instability over central California during the late afternoon for strong thunderstorms to develop over Yosemite National Park. One cell produced pea sized hail which accumulated to an inch in depth while flash flooding was reported in Hetch Hetchy. Meanwhile, an isolated thunderstorm in Bakersfield produced half an inch of rainfall in about one hour which set a new daily record.
